Mayor Sukkur and Spokesperson for the Sindh Government, Barrister Arsalan Islam Sheikh, on Friday hosted a graceful farewell luncheon at his residence in honour of the United Nations Resident Coordinator and Humanitarian Coordinator in Pakistan, Muhammad Yahya.
The luncheon was organized to acknowledge Yahya’s invaluable services while leading the UN System in Pakistan, to pay tribute to his contributions, and to congratulate him on his appointment to a key global leadership position in the United Nations.
During his tenure as UN Resident and Humanitarian Coordinator in Pakistan, Yahya led the UN System and played a significant role in:
- Humanitarian welfare
- Sustainable development
- Climate change
- Disaster response
- Humanitarian assistance
- Support for vulnerable communities
Muhammad Yahya has been appointed as Assistant Secretary-General of the United Nations by the UN Secretary-General. The appointment marks his transition from a pivotal leadership role in Pakistan to a senior global responsibility, and reflects confidence in his professional capabilities and services.

On the occasion, speakers paid rich tributes to Yahya’s services as Resident and Humanitarian Coordinator in Pakistan and appreciated the UN’s role in sustainable development, humanitarian welfare, climate resilience, disaster response, and support for vulnerable communities.
Congratulating Muhammad Yahya on assuming the prestigious responsibility of Assistant Secretary-General, Barrister Arsalan Islam Sheikh said the appointment is not only recognition of his professional competence and leadership but also of his invaluable services in Pakistan.
He said that Yahya discharged his responsibilities in Pakistan with exceptional dedication, vision, and humanitarian spirit, and under his leadership, cooperation between the United Nations and Pakistan was further strengthened.
Barrister Sheikh said that Yahya’s departure from Pakistan is certainly the loss of a valued personality, however, his new global assignment reflects recognition of his abilities and global trust in him. He prayed that Yahya would continue to serve humanity with the same spirit, commitment, and success in his new role.
